"Lovely hotel, slightly away from the busy area but directly above Kitahama station so very convenient for getting around. The 62 bus stops nearby which takes about 10 mins to / from Osaka Castle.
The breakfast buffet was good value at 2300Y. It was varied and plentiful with a good selection of food & drink. There were some nice local restaurants nearby including Lien which is great fun and just across the road.
We had a triple room for 2 people which meant we had a bit of space and it was beautifully quiet.
There were lots of extras included - pyjamas, slippers, a free drink every day. There were also some amazing free face-masks & beauty products - we looked 10 years younger after a 26 hour journey from the UK!"

What can I see and do near Hokoku Shrine?
Osaka Museum of History, Osaka Museum of Housing and Living and Osaka Science Museum fe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Osaka Tenmangu Shrine, Osaka Central Public Hall and Hozen-ji Temple are notable landmarks to explore if you're in the area. You can catch a show at Osaka Shinkabukiza Theater, Festival Hall and Orix Theater.
